Finding the right ADHD provider in Chandler starts with understanding the type of care you need. Therapists — such as licensed professional counselors (LPCs), licensed clinical social workers (LCSWs), and psychologists — can help with building coping strategies, improving focus, and addressing the emotional impact of ADHD through approaches like cognitive behavioral therapy (CBT). If you're also looking for medication management, a psychiatrist or psychiatric nurse practitioner can evaluate and prescribe as part of your care plan. Some people choose to work with both a therapist and a prescribing clinician as part of their care, depending on their needs and after consulting with a qualified healthcare professional.
With Chandler's proximity to Mesa, Gilbert, and Tempe, you have access to a broad range of ADHD specialists across the East Valley. Consider what matters most to you when choosing a provider — whether that's experience with adult ADHD, support for a child or teen, a specific therapeutic approach, or the option to meet virtually. Reading a provider's bio can help you understand their style and decide if they're a good match before booking.
